An individual can apply to court for a decree of nullity to annul the marriage on grounds that the marriage is either void or voidable. It is effectively a pre-condition that the marriage must be void or voidable before a decree of nullity is given.

In Massachusetts, under the M.G.L. Chapter 207, Section 14, either party is allowed to file a Complaint for Annulment. A marriage annulment is not dissolution in marriage, but rather a declaration that no marriage ever existed between the parties.
